Universal Design Image Collection

March 26, 2011

Communicating about universal design is greatly facilitated by using images of the designed environment. One of the challenging aspects of defining and promoting universal design has been the lack of a common visual reference to do so.

The staff of UDI, under contract with the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), have posted a collection of hundreds of catalogued and described universal design images on the CDC's Public Health Image Library (PHIL). The unique and free collection can be found on line at http://phil.cdc.gov/phil/home.asp. Use search term "universal design" to access the images.
